The Seventh Annual Small Business Week May 6-11, 2019. A series of workshops will be held Monday to Thursday evenings. The finals of the Business Plan and Pitch Competition will pit three finalists against one another vying for a $3,300 cash and other prizes on Saturday, May 11. Before, during and after the Pitch Competition, Member businesses of NaperLaunch will be on display showcasing their products and services to the community in the NaperLaunch Small Business Showcase from 10:00 a.m. to 1:00 p.m. NaperLaunch members may reserve space at the Showcase and meet local residents as they visit the Pitch Competition Finals and other library visitors on a busy Saturday. Shark Tank Survivor: 'Predict the Future and Then Prepare for It'
Monday, May 6, 6:30 - 8:00 p.m.
Scott Palmer, COO at Spikeball, Inc., shares experiences related to building a global brand while staying lean and nimble. Learn about leadership, people management, the process of establishing a playbook of best approaches to getting work done and learning for the sake of learning.

Cybersecurity for the Small Business
Tuesday, May 7, 6:30 - 8:30 p.m.
Address the key areas on how to protect IP and data: security assessment, IT support & hardware, software and data breach insurance. Learn where businesses are at risk, what can be done to protect a business, understand changing regulatory compliance, why cloud solutions are not as secure as one might think, and a checklist guiding through complex cyber threats. Presented by Brian Berglund, CTO, Armarius Software.

NaperLaunch Marketing Series Workshop: Instagram - Part 1
Wednesday, May 8, 6:30 - 8:00 p.m.
In Part 1 of Instagram Marketing, participants will learn how to: Create and execute strategic goals using the Instagram platform.Optimize posts to attract followers. Test messaging and learn from metrics to improve engagement. Presented by Lindsay Harmon, Adult Services Librarian at Naperville Public Library.

SCORE Business Roundtable
Thursday, May 9, 8:00 - 9:30 a.m.
A moderated open discussion addressing issues faced by the entrepreneurs and business owners who attend. Use this roundtable discussion as an advisory group to gain new insights, different perspectives and new techniques. Participants come away better prepared to startup or manage a business.

E-commerce Basics
Thursday, May 9, 6:30 - 8:30 p.m.
Learn the basics of creating and running an E-commerce business, the value of web design, partner arrangements, and market pricing. Presented by Bob Koch, founder of Quiver Global Inc.

Business Plan and Pitch Competition Finals
Saturday, May 11, 11:00 a.m. - 12:30 p.m.
Local entrepreneurs will participate in a business plan and pitch competition. Finalists will pitch their plan publicly to be judged by a panel of experienced entrepreneurs, venture capitalists and angel investors.
